#69056f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#69056f is composed of 41.2% red, 2% green and 43.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 5.4% cyan, 95.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 56.5% black. It has a hue angle of 296.6 degrees, a saturation of 91.4% and a lightness of 22.7%. #69056f color hex could be obtained by blending #d20ade with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660066.

● #69056f color description : Very dark magenta.
#69056f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#69056f has RGB values of R:105, G:5, B:111 and CMYK values of C:0.05, M:0.95, Y:0, K:0.56. Its decimal value is 6882671.
